Housing Compliance policies
From: Cabinet Committee: Housing - Tuesday, 4th November, 2025 10.00 am - November 04, 2025
...that the Cabinet Committee: Housing of Winchester approved and adopted six Housing Repairs and Maintenance Compliance Policies concerning fire safety, gas and heating, electrical safety, asbestos, water hygiene, and lift safety, while delegating authority to the Corporate Head of Housing, in consultation with the Cabinet Member for Good Homes, to make minor amendments.

Disabled Facilities Grants Policy 2025-2028
From: Cabinet Committee: Housing - Tuesday, 4th November, 2025 10.00 am - November 04, 2025
...that the Disabled Facilities Grant policy for 2025-2030, as detailed in Appendix 1 of report CAB3521(H), was approved, and authority was delegated to the Corporate Head of Housing, in consultation with the Cabinet Member for Healthy Communities, to make minor or legislative-related changes to the policy.

Woodman Close, Sparsholt - Final Business Case (less exempt appendix)
From: Cabinet - Tuesday, 14th October, 2025 9.30 am - October 14, 2025
...to facilitate the construction of five new council homes at Woodman Close, Sparsholt, the Cabinet authorized the Corporate Head of Asset Management to award a JCT Design & Build Contract, negotiate related agreements, approved a budget increase of £101,000 to meet the total scheme cost of £2,057,000, and agreed to deploy S106 affordable housing developer contribution funding, with the Strategic Director authorized to deploy additional funding or increase rents if Homes England funding is insufficient.
